用户提问: 如何生成ai图片
Ai回答: 生成AI图片的过程通常依赖于深度学习模型,尤其是生成对抗网络(GANs)、扩散模型(Diffusion Models)或变分自编码器(VAE)等技术。以下是一个详细的步骤指南,帮助你理解如何生成AI图片:
1、确定需求和工具
首先,明确你想要生成的图片类型(例如人物、风景、抽象艺术等),以及你希望使用的工具或平台。以下是几种常见的选择:
在线工具/平台:如MidJourney、DALL·E 2、Stable Diffusion WebUI、Runway ML等。
本地运行软件:如Stable Diffusion、ComfyUI、DeepArt等。
编程实现:使用Python结合深度学习框架(如PyTorch、TensorFlow)自行训练或调用预训练模型。
如果你是初学者,建议从在线工具开始;如果你有编程基础,可以尝试本地运行或定制化开发。
2、使用在线工具生成AI图片
步骤:
1、选择一个平台:
[MidJourney](https://www.midjourney.com/):适合高质量艺术风格图片。
[DALL·E 2](https://openai.com/dall-e-2):由OpenAI开发,适合多种场景生成。
[Stable Diffusion Online](https://stablediffusionweb.com/):开源且功能强大。
2、输入提示词(Prompt):
提示词是描述你想要生成内容的关键短语。例如:
A futuristic cityscape at sunset, cyberpunk style, ultra-detailed, cinematic lighting
提示词越具体,生成效果越好。你可以包括风格(如“印象派”、“写实”)、颜色、光线等细节。
3、调整参数(如果支持):
分辨率:选择图片的尺寸,例如512x512或1024x1024。
种子值(Seed):控制随机性,相同种子值会生成相似图片。
步数(Steps):影响生成质量,通常步数越高,图片越精细。
4、生成并下载:
平台会根据你的提示词生成图片,你可以选择满意的结果并下载。
3、本地运行AI生成工具
如果你想在自己的电脑上生成AI图片,可以选择安装开源工具,例如Stable Diffusion。
步骤:
1、准备环境:
确保你的电脑有GPU支持(推荐NVIDIA显卡)。
安装必要的软件,如Python、CUDA驱动程序等。
2、下载Stable Diffusion:
访问[Stable Diffusion GitHub](https://github.com/AUTOMATIC1111/stable-diffusion-webui)页面,按照说明克隆代码库并安装依赖。
3、运行WebUI:
启动WebUI后,打开浏览器访问本地地址(通常是`http://localhost:7860`)。
在界面中输入提示词并调整参数,点击“Generate”按钮生成图片。
4、优化与迭代:
如果生成结果不理想,可以尝试修改提示词、调整参数或更换模型。
4、编程实现AI图片生成
如果你熟悉编程,可以通过深度学习框架直接生成AI图片。以下是一个简单的例子,使用PyTorch加载预训练的Stable Diffusion模型。
代码示例:
python
from diffusers import StableDiffusionPipeline
import torch
加载预训练模型
model_id = runwayml/stable-diffusion-v1-5
pipe = StableDiffusionPipeline.from_pretrained(model_id, torch_dtype=torch.float16)
pipe = pipe.to(cuda) 使用GPU加速
输入提示词
prompt = A magical forest with glowing trees and a shimmering lake, fantasy art style
生成图片
image = pipe(prompt).images[0]
保存图片
image.save(generated_image.png)
所需库:
`diffusers`:用于加载扩散模型。
`torch`:深度学习框架。
注意事项:
确保你的设备支持CUDA,并安装了合适的PyTorch版本。
下载预训练模型可能需要较大的存储空间和良好的网络连接。
5、提高生成效果的小技巧
优化提示词:
使用清晰、具体的语言描述目标图片。
添加风格关键词,如“photorealistic”(写实)、“watercolor”(水彩)等。
尝试不同的模型:
不同的模型擅长不同类型的图片生成,例如Stable Diffusion适合通用场景,而Waifu Diffusion专注于动漫风格。
后期处理:
使用图像编辑软件(如Photoshop)对生成结果进行微调,提升最终效果。
6、注意事项
版权问题:部分生成的图片可能涉及版权争议,确保了解相关法律。
伦理问题:避免生成包含敏感内容或可能引发争议的图片。
硬件要求:生成高质量图片通常需要强大的计算资源,尤其是本地运行时。
通过以上方法,你可以轻松生成AI图片。如果你有更具体的需求或遇到问题,欢迎进一步提问!
0
IP地址: 21.225.46.67
搜索次数: 6
提问时间: 2025-04-23 19:47:49
热门提问:
成人ai智能
ai智能娃娃
ai分析股票走势
前海开源MSCI中国A股消费A
ai网格渐变教程